Ethereum
Block
21095536
0xb908423d29fbcf71d2c79cad41db6c41f8482737
EOA
Active on
Ethereum with -- and
19 txns
Funded by
0xb5d8
…
f511
via
0xd864
…
9ff0
First active
9 days ago
Last active
4 days ago
Loading...